Nowhere to Turn (2008)
Before deciding to register entering the university abroad, Soo-yeon who wants to be a musician faces the objection of her family who ignores her dream. She tries to find a way to make her dream come true, but the chance is not on her side. Finally, she challenges to a musician contest with her old friend, Dong-ho who is the only one trusts in her.
Director: Lee Sung-young
Genre: Drama, Romance, Music
Runtime: 106 min
Release Date: August 21, 2008
